Pota Population - Akola, Maharashtra
Pota is a small village located in Murtijapur Taluka of Akola district, Maharashtra with total 40 families residing. The Pota village has population of 183 of which 92 are males while 91 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Pota village population of children with age 0-6 is 22 which makes up 12.02 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Pota village is 989 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Pota as per census is 571,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.
Pota village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Pota village was 75.78 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Pota Male literacy stands at 83.33 % while female literacy rate was 68.67 %.

Pota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 40 | - | - |
Population | 183 | 92 | 91 |
Child (0-6) | 22 | 14 | 8 |
Schedule Caste | 164 | 83 | 81 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 75.78 % | 83.33 % | 68.67 % |
Total Workers | 104 | 54 | 50 |
Main Worker | 44 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 60 | 22 | 38 |
